During his speech, Vance referenced how Germany's government has conducted raids against individuals posting "Anti-feminist comments online" in order to "combat misogyny online." And Sweden, where a Christian individual who participated in Koran burnings that resulted in his friend's murder, because that country's laws that supposedly protect free expression do not allow you to "risk offending" those who hold different beliefs.

Vance followed those examples up by referencing how the British government charged a man for silently praying for three minutes 50 meters from an abortion clinic. When asked by police why he was praying, that man said it was for the son he and his then girlfriend had aborted years prior.  

Scotland warned some residents that private prayer, in their own homes, could be punished as a "thought crime," if it came within a "safe-access zone" for abortions. 

As Vance summarized, "In Britain, and across Europe, free speech, I fear, is in retreat." And he's absolutely right.
